First, let’s consider what "best" truly means for your family. For some, a play-based approach that emphasizes social interaction and exploration through hands-on activities is paramount. Others may seek a program with a more structured routine that gently introduces early literacy and math concepts. The good news is that within a short drive from Corbettsville, you’ll find wonderful programs in neighboring communities like Conklin, Vestal, and Binghamton that offer this variety. The best first step is to reflect on your child’s unique personality. Are they a cautious observer who thrives with gentle encouragement, or an energetic explorer who needs ample space for movement? Matching the school’s philosophy to your child’s temperament is key.

Don’t hesitate to look just beyond our immediate zip code; a fifteen-minute drive can open up fantastic possibilities. The most important part of your search will be the in-person visit. Schedule a time to observe a classroom in action. Look for teachers who are on the floor engaging with children, listen for the sound of happy and productive chatter, and notice if the space feels organized yet inviting. Trust your instincts—you’ll feel the atmosphere when you walk in.
When you visit, come prepared with questions. Ask about teacher qualifications and longevity, the daily schedule, and how they handle social-emotional learning, like sharing or resolving conflicts. Inquire about their communication with parents; regular updates about your child’s day are so valuable. Also, consider the practicalities: what are the safety protocols, what is the student-to-teacher ratio, and does the school calendar align with your family’s needs?
